summ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Arthur Zamarin <arthurzam@gentoo.org>2024-07-06 22:20:20 +0300
committerArthur Zamarin <arthurzam@gentoo.org>2024-07-06 22:20:20 +0300
commit405d98dbd6ac26574e8f73e390e23b1ec3d85d6a (patch)
tree228de8066f88d835a9a8b2ee5fab3e6188da0bba /app-admin/cdist
parentdev-python/pytest-sugar: enable py3.13 (diff)
downloadgentoo-405d98dbd6ac26574e8f73e390e23b1ec3d85d6a.tar.gz
gentoo-405d98dbd6ac26574e8f73e390e23b1ec3d85d6a.tar.bz2
gentoo-405d98dbd6ac26574e8f73e390e23b1ec3d85d6a.zip
app-admin/cdist: PEP517, enable py3.13, fix missing doc dep
Closes: https://bugs.gentoo.org/928845 Closes: https://bugs.gentoo.org/922107 Closes: https://bugs.gentoo.org/909859 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Diffstat (limited to 'app-admin/cdist')
-rw-r--r--app-admin/cdist/cdist-7.0.0-r1.ebuild (renamed from app-admin/cdist/cdist-7.0.0.ebuild)9
1 files changed, 5 insertions, 4 deletions
diff --git a/app-admin/cdist/cdist-7.0.0.ebuild b/app-admin/cdist/cdist-7.0.0-r1.ebuild
index 6a67147f107c..7186e9fecd36 100644
--- a/app-admin/cdist/cdist-7.0.0.ebuild
+++ b/app-admin/cdist/cdist-7.0.0-r1.ebuild
@@ -3,9 +3,8 @@
EAPI=8
-PYTHON_COMPAT=( python3_{10..12} )
-
-DISTUTILS_USE_SETUPTOOLS=no
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{10..13} )
inherit distutils-r1
@@ -18,7 +17,9 @@ LICENSE="GPL-3+"
SLOT="0"
KEYWORDS="~amd64 ~ppc64 ~x86"
-distutils_enable_sphinx docs/src dev-python/sphinx-rtd-theme
+distutils_enable_sphinx docs/src \
+ dev-python/sphinx-rtd-theme \
+ dev-python/six
distutils_enable_tests unittest
python_prepare_all() {